The Use of Radiographic Tools in Practice
Diagnostic imaging aids facilitate routine radiographic tasks by enabling precision, staff safety, and efficient workflows. Although X-ray systems receive the most attention, secondary tools such as lead safety eyewear, shielding gloves, positioning aids, and radiographic markers impact image clarity and facilitate proper positioning.
These tools tackle practical challenges faced by radiographers, from ensuring accurate side marking to minimising scatter radiation. Their consistent application helps maintain clinical accuracy across imaging sessions.
Essential Safety Accessories
Lead-lined eyewear serve to shield the eyes from secondary radiation, especially in procedures requiring proximity, such as mobile scans. Many models include side guards and optical prescriptions to improve comfort for wearers.
Radiation-attenuating gloves safeguard the hands when manipulating patients or holding medical equipment. Constructed from protective compounds, they retain dexterity, which is crucial for ensuring accurate handling. Gloves must fit well to avoid interference.
Accurate Side Labelling
Radiographic markers serve the important task of displaying anatomical side and orientation directly on the captured image. They reduce interpretation errors and support regulatory accuracy.
Available in multiple designs, including bespoke models and lead-free alternatives, markers help with precise documentation and lower the risk of repeat exposures.
Patient Comfort and Positioning Support
Positioning aids are used to help proper alignment and limiting shifts during scanning. These are particularly useful for specific patients such as read more trauma patients, children, or the elderly.
Common examples include angled supports, sponge inserts, and position locks. Their use improves scan clarity, and supports smoother imaging workflows.
What to Consider When Buying Radiographic Accessories
When choosing radiographic accessories, essential criteria such as ease of disinfection, material durability, and equipment compatibility should be weighed. Accessories intended for daily use should support long-term application without frequent replacement.
Where MRI compatibility is required, opt for MRI-safe designs to eliminate risk while still providing functional parity to standard radiographic tools.
Frequently Asked Questions About Radiographic Accessories
- Do we still need markers with digital imaging?
Absolutely. Digital annotations can be altered, whereas physical markers are imprinted on the original image, here offering a definitive guide. - How regularly should protective gear be inspected?
Protective equipment should be examined periodically, particularly with high utilisation, to detect any degradation. - Can positioning aids be reused?
Yes, if they are sanitised according to infection control guidance and remain intact. - Will protective glasses hinder vision?
High-grade glasses offer transparent lenses while maintaining safety standards. - Do these tools reduce image repeats?
Correct labelling and accurate alignment minimise repeat exposures, saving time and radiation dose.
